Peer reviewedCarpenter, Thomas P. – Education and Urban Society, 1985
Children's solutions to simple word problems requiring addition or subtraction skills develop through four stages: (1) modeling with objects; (2) utilization of both modeling and counting strategies; (3) reliance on counting strategies; and (4) reliance on number facts. Dewey, Paul – Children and Animals, 1985
Explains how Venn diagrams can be used to teach children about animals. Provides examples of four types of diagrams and suggests how activities can be designed to address topics as endangered, domestic, and wild animals. (ML)
